Red Bull Global Rallycross Race Recap: Volkswagen Rallycross NY IN BRIEF: Tanner Foust’s miserable luck from the onset of the 2014 Red Bull Global Rallycross season appears to be firmly behind him, as his constant speed finally delivered him a victory in Volkswagen Rallycross NY on Sunday. After a penalty to Scott Speed erased a Volkswagen Andretti Rallycross 1-2 finish, Nelson Piquet Jr. stepped up into second place and the points lead, and Ken Block earned his first podium of the year. Today, we were reminded of the dangers and risks inherent in all forms of motorsport, even autocross, in the most heartbreaking way. The Texas Region of the SCCA was holding a Solo Event in one of the parking lots at the Texas Motor Speedway just north of Fort Worth, TX. Kierstin Eaddy, a 14 year-old girl racing her Formula Junior kart suffered a fatal accident after finishing one of her runs. Well it’s official and expected. David Higgins and Craig Drew of Subaru Rally Team USA win the New England Forest Rally, and with that the overall 2014 Rally America National Championship. This is their 4th consecutive Rally America title and there are still two events remaining to run. Their combination of blazing fast pace and consistency is unrivaled and not likely to be overcome anytime soon. This past weekend, the Kansas City and Kansas Regions of the SCCA held their first of three joint Solo Event weekends at Heartland Park Topeka. For the Kansas City Region, the Saturday/Sunday double-header were Events 6 and 7. If was the first two events of the year for the Kansas Region. Both the Saturday and Sunday courses were designed by Ron Williams and incorporated many of the elements from the 2013 SCCA Solo Nationals course.
